Job Description:
Are you a dedicated social worker with a passion for supporting kinship families.
In this role, you will work closely with kinship carers and children, providing the necessary assessments, support, and guidance to ensure the best outcomes for children in kinship care.
Responsibilities:
- Providing ongoing support and supervision to kinship carers, helping them navigate the challenges of caring for children within their family or social network.
- Developing and implementing support plans tailored to the needs of the child and the kinship carers.
- Working collaboratively with other professionals, including social workers, health professionals, and educators, to coordinate care and services for children in kinship placements.
- Ensuring compliance with relevant legislation, policies, and procedures related to kinship care and child protection.
- Advocating for the needs of the child and the kinship carers within the wider social care system.
Qualifications:
- Qualified Social Worker registered with Social Work England.
- Proven experience in a social work role, preferably within kinship care, fostering, or children's services.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build strong relationships with kinship carers, children, and professionals.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a multidisciplinary team.
- Knowledge of relevant legislation, policies, and procedures related to kinship care and child protection.
